The PWC has begun preparations for the OPSEU Convention 2007. We have started to develop resolutions on several issues including "Sisters in Spirit" and the International Solidarity Fund. 

The "Sisters in Spirit" campaign was launched in March 2004 in response to the alarmingly high levels of violence against Aboriginal Women in Canada and the number of women who have been lost to violence. 

Plans are underway for the PWC Breakfast held the Friday morning of Convention. The Committee is currently accepting nominations for regional awards.  In addition, the PWC has contributed a list of pertinent questions for the candidates’ equity bear pit session at Convention.

The Committee has begun work on the Women's Conference which is scheduled to take place in the fall of 2007.  Location is to be determined.  The theme will be based on issues facing women internationally.

The budget and work plan were reviewed and a discussion took place around activities for Dec. 6.  Each region will either participate in activities with their labour councils, community groups or develop their own activities. 

A new course has been developed by OPSEU's Training and Development Unit called "Women in Unions: Strengthening Leadership".  This was piloted in the London educational held in Oct.
